🌟 Why Wall Panels Are Your Basement’s New Best Friend
Wall panels aren’t just slabs of wood or plaster slapped on for aesthetics; they’re like the superhero cape your basement’s been begging for. They hide cracks, insulate against that creepy chill, and scream sophistication without you breaking the bank. I once helped a friend panel her basement with reclaimed barn wood—total rustic vibes—and the space went from “spider haven” to “Pinterest board” in a weekend. Choose panels in bold textures like shiplap for a farmhouse feel or sleek PVC for a modern edge. Whatever you pick, they set the stage for decor magic.

🪞 Mirrors: Bouncing Light Like Nobody’s Business
Basements can feel like caves, but mirrors are your secret weapon. Hang a oversized round mirror above a console table to reflect candlelight and make the space feel twice as big. Or, lean a full-length mirror against a paneled wall for drama. I once scored a thrift-store mirror with a gilded frame, plopped it in my basement, and it was like the room got a facelift. Pro tip: place mirrors opposite windows (if you’re lucky enough to have them) to maximize light and make your panels gleam.

💡 Lighting: The Unsung Hero of Basement Decor
Lighting can make or break your paneled paradise. String fairy lights along the top of your panels for a whimsical touch, or install sconces for a grown-up glow. I rigged up some cheap LED strips behind my panels, and the ambient light made my basement feel like a speakeasy. Combine floor lamps, table lamps, and candles to layer light, ensuring your decor—from planters to mirrors—gets the spotlight it deserves.
